Sterlite Bags BSNL Contract
Sterlite to deploy a central office broadband system in telecom circles, pan India.
Sterlite Technologies Limited (Sterlite), a global provider of transmission solutions for the power and telecom industries, announced that it has received a contract from BSNL, for deployment of a central office broadband system in telecom circles, pan India.
Sterlite has streamlined its efforts to implement these Central Office broadband systems well within the required project schedule. “Sterlite has developed the capability to provide comprehensive solutions for the telecom & broadband sectors. We remain committed to facilitating the propagation of broadband in India,” said Rahul Sharma, Head – System Integration Business, Sterlite Technologies.
The Company would install and commission the system within FY13 and would manage this network for 7 years thereafter. The system, once completed, would be capable of handling about 1.6 million broadband connections.
This contract valued at about Rs. 114 Crores, is part of a total bank of new orders valued at about Rs. 560 Crores that Sterlite has received since July 1, 2011.
